Re: Build 961
Whatever you want. If they're OK, you can leave them. You can delete them at any time, with Cumulus stopped, and it will attempt to rebuild them when it starts.SUBYDAZZ wrote:Just to clarify, are we supposed to delete month.ini and year.ini before we install any update beyond 9.58?
